Output 33bda154007d32e80d046c0c1e0317ace9113ea54e371aee70a4c224b98e86c6:0

value
590062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d5e618ed546565a784a0279005ea0535c916eb9 OP_EQUALVERIFY OP_CHECKSIG
address
13gHfH14qeC3LTkv7xoac9CAj5ESaPEVGd
transaction
33bda154007d32e80d046c0c1e0317ace9113ea54e371aee70a4c224b98e86c6
spent
true